      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I have this following problem. I would like to share my parent file to my client without needing him to download revit or buying subscription. There are ways to share your revit file to open in browser, right?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;You can share it via autodesk viewer, but you have to renew it in every 30 days.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;You can share it via autodesk drive, but the parent file system is not working in drive, it has to be a single file,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;You can share it via autodesk 360docs, however the correspondant cannot open it without having a bim360docs (acc subscription)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I really don't understand how I , a paid customer, share my file with multiple links for a period longer than 30 days.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Is there a way to do this?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thanks in advance&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;I think I couldn't explain myself clearly. My question had nothing to do with google or any other product beside Autodesk.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;My question is, what is the best way to share a revit model with multiple links to a non-autodesk user to review on browser?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Autodesk has 3 answers for this none of them works perfectly so I am asking if I am missing something: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;1-Autodesk viewer can be used. but it permits the file to be shared only for 30days ( you have to renew the link every month to keep it alive)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;2-Autodesk drive can be used. Any file shared from Autodesk drive can also be reviewed on browser. However autodesk drive doesn't provide this feature if the revit file has multiple links.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;3-Autodesk 360 docs can be used. It also supports revit files with multiple links. However, it requires the correspondent to have a paid autodesk subscription in order to review the file in browser.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
